The Chicago Sun Times reported this week that “75 people visited Chicago Police headquarters” to get applications to register their handguns. The paper more importantly offered this quote from Police Superintendent Jody Weis regarding the new registration process:
“We want to know who has weapons so that first responders can be award of that information before they enter a home.”
This “first responder” argument has been made before, but we must question whether this is really an issue in an emergency? Is there a more ominous reason as to why the Chicago PD might want to know who has a gun?
